Jelly with vodka in lemon peels topcook.tomathouse.com
Ingredients:
- 3 tbsp. l. powdered gelatin
- 3/4 cup ultrafine or light brown sugar
- 10 large lemons
- 2 tbsp. cranberry juice cocktail
- 1 cup of vodka or water
Preparation:
- In a small saucepan, bring 0.5 cups of water to a boil over medium-high heat. Remove from heat and add the gelatin. Stir until completely dissolved. Add the sugar and stir until completely dissolved. Let sit for 5 minutes.
- Meanwhile, cut each lemon in half lengthwise. Carefully scoop the pulp out of the rind and transfer it to a small bowl, being careful not to damage the rind; set the rinds aside. Mash the pulp to release the lemon juice. Strain through a fine sieve. You'll need 1 cup of freshly squeezed juice. Discard the pulp.
- Combine lemon juice, cranberry juice, and gelatin mixture in a large pitcher. Add vodka.
- Place the lemon peel halves on a rimmed baking sheet and pour the gelatin mixture into each half. Refrigerate until completely set (the jelly should not stick to your finger when touched), about 8 hours or overnight.
- To serve, cut each lemon half into 3 wedges.
